2
2
* @namespace selector
3
3
*/
4
4
5
- import { createSelector } from 'reselect'
6
- import { denormalize } from './helper'
7
- import { ACTIONS_REDUCER_NAME , ENTITIES_REDUCER_NAME , IS_TEST_ENVIRONMENT } from './config'
5
+ import { createSelector } from 'reselect'
6
+ import { denormalize } from './helper'
7
+ import {
8
+ ACTIONS_REDUCER_NAME ,
9
+ ENTITIES_REDUCER_NAME ,
10
+ IS_TEST_ENVIRONMENT
11
+ } from './config'
8
12
9
13
const defaultActionDataOutput = {
10
14
status : '' ,
@@ -36,10 +40,12 @@ const getPayloadIds = (dataKey, isArray, actionState, stateKey) => {
36
40
return isArray ? payloadIds : [ payloadIds ]
37
41
}
38
42
39
- const makeActionDenormalizedPayload = ( isArray ,
40
- payloadIds ,
41
- schema ,
42
- entities ) => {
43
+ const makeActionDenormalizedPayload = (
44
+ isArray ,
45
+ payloadIds ,
46
+ schema ,
47
+ entities
48
+ ) => {
43
49
// return empty immutable object
44
50
if ( ! payloadIds ) {
45
51
return undefined
@@ -50,13 +56,15 @@ const makeActionDenormalizedPayload = (isArray,
50
56
return isArray ? result : result [ 0 ]
51
57
}
52
58
53
- const makeActionDenormalizedPayloads = ( isFetching ,
54
- actionSchema ,
55
- entities ,
56
- payloadIsArray ,
57
- actionDataKey ,
58
- entityState ,
59
- actionState ) => {
59
+ const makeActionDenormalizedPayloads = (
60
+ isFetching ,
61
+ actionSchema ,
62
+ entities ,
63
+ payloadIsArray ,
64
+ actionDataKey ,
65
+ entityState ,
66
+ actionState
67
+ ) => {
60
68
if ( ! actionDataKey ) {
61
69
return undefined
62
70
}
@@ -161,8 +169,12 @@ export const getMergedActionsData = (...actions) => {
161
169
162
170
return sortedByUpate . reduce ( ( memo , item ) => {
163
171
return Object . assign ( memo , item , {
164
- payload : memo . payload ? memo . payload . merge ( item . payload ) : item . payload ,
165
- prevPayload : memo . prevPayload ? memo . prevPayload . merge ( item . prevPayload ) : item . prevPayload
172
+ payload : memo . payload
173
+ ? memo . payload . merge ( item . payload )
174
+ : item . payload ,
175
+ prevPayload : memo . prevPayload
176
+ ? memo . prevPayload . merge ( item . prevPayload )
177
+ : item . prevPayload
166
178
} )
167
179
} )
168
180
}
0 commit comments